Daniel Greenfeld is co-author of Two Scoops of Django: Best Practices for Django 1.5 and co-creator and maintainer of Django Packages and the underlying OpenComparison framework.

Working with Steve Holden, he helped author two out of a series of four classes on Python 3 for the O'Reilly School of Technology. Before that he worked for NASA as a software engineer.

Daniel met his fiancée, Audrey Roy, at PyCon 2010. Since then, he has led various Python and open source community initiatives, including PyCon Philippines and the LA Open Source Hackathon series.

Daniel is a principal at Cartwheel Web, a consulting firm in Los Angeles specializing in Python and Django web applications.
